Porto’s iconic sandwich layered with cured meats and steak, covered with melted cheese and a rich beer-tomato sauce, often served with fries.
Traditional tripe stew with white beans, sausages, and pork, closely tied to Porto’s culinary identity and history.
Classic Porto-style salt cod casserole with potatoes, onion, olive oil, egg, and olives, named after a Porto merchant.

Moderate by Western Europe standards. Local cafés are good value, while central hotels and fine dining cost more.
Service is usually included. Rounding up or leaving 5-10% for good restaurant service is appreciated, not required. Small tips for taxis are optional.
